Aracılığıyla paylaş


Set-AzSynapseSqlScript

Çalışma alanında SQL betiği oluşturur veya güncelleştirir.

Syntax

Set-AzSynapseSqlScript
   -WorkspaceName <String>
   [-Name <String>]
   -DefinitionFile <String>
   [-ResultLimit <Int32>]
   [-FolderPath <String>]
   [-Description <String>]
   [-AsJob]
   [-DefaultProfile <IAzureContextContainer>]
   [-WhatIf]
   [-Confirm]
   [<CommonParameters>]
Set-AzSynapseSqlScript
   -WorkspaceName <String>
   -SqlPoolName <String>
   -SqlDatabaseName <String>
   [-Name <String>]
   -DefinitionFile <String>
   [-ResultLimit <Int32>]
   [-FolderPath <String>]
   [-Description <String>]
   [-AsJob]
   [-DefaultProfile <IAzureContextContainer>]
   [-WhatIf]
   [-Confirm]
   [<CommonParameters>]
Set-AzSynapseSqlScript
   -WorkspaceObject <PSSynapseWorkspace>
   [-Name <String>]
   -DefinitionFile <String>
   [-ResultLimit <Int32>]
   [-FolderPath <String>]
   [-Description <String>]
   [-AsJob]
   [-DefaultProfile <IAzureContextContainer>]
   [-WhatIf]
   [-Confirm]
   [<CommonParameters>]
Set-AzSynapseSqlScript
   -WorkspaceObject <PSSynapseWorkspace>
   -SqlPoolName <String>
   -SqlDatabaseName <String>
   [-Name <String>]
   -DefinitionFile <String>
   [-ResultLimit <Int32>]
   [-FolderPath <String>]
   [-Description <String>]
   [-AsJob]
   [-DefaultProfile <IAzureContextContainer>]
   [-WhatIf]
   [-Confirm]
   [<CommonParameters>]

Description

Set-AzSynapseSqlScript cmdlet'i çalışma alanında bir SQL betiği oluşturur veya güncelleştirir.

Örnekler

Örnek 1

Set-AzSynapseSqlScript -WorkspaceName ContosoWorkspace -DefinitionFile "C:\\samples\\sqlscript.sql"

Bu komut, ContosoWorkspace adlı çalışma alanında sqlscript.sql SQL betik dosyasından bir SQL betiği oluşturur veya güncelleştirir.

Örnek 2

$ws = Get-AzSynapseWorkspace -Name ContosoWorkspace
$ws | Set-AzSynapseSqlScript -DefinitionFile "C:\\samples\\sqlscript.sql"

Bu komut, ContosoWorkspace adlı çalışma alanında sqlscript.sql SQL betik dosyasından bir SQL betiği oluşturur veya güncelleştirir.

Örnek 3

Set-AzSynapseSqlScript -WorkspaceName ContosoWorkspace -DefinitionFile "C:\\samples\\sqlscript.sql"  -SqlPoolName Contososqlpool -SqlDatabaseName Contosodatabase

Bu komut, ContosoSqlPool'a bağlanan ve ContosoWorkspace adlı çalışma alanında Contosodatabase adlı veritabanını kullanan sqlscript.sql SQL betik dosyasından bir SQL betiği oluşturur veya güncelleştirir.

Parametreler

-AsJob

Cmdlet'i arka planda çalıştırma

Type:SwitchParameter
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-Confirm

Cmdlet'i çalıştırmadan önce sizden onay ister.

Type:SwitchParameter
Aliases:cf
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-DefaultProfile

Azure ile iletişim için kullanılan kimlik bilgileri, hesap, kiracı ve abonelik.

Type:IAzureContextContainer
Aliases:AzContext, AzureRmContext, AzureCredential
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-DefinitionFile

SQL dosya yolu.

Type:String
Aliases:File
Position:Named
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-Description

SQL betiğinin açıklaması.

Type:String
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-FolderPath

Bu SQL betiğinin içinde olduğu klasör. [rootFolder/subFolder] gibi çok düzeyli bir yol belirtirseniz, SqlScript alt düzeyde görünür. Belirtilmezse, bu SQL betiği kök düzeyinde görünür.

Type:String
Aliases:FolderName
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-Name

SQL betiği adı.

Type:String
Aliases:SqlScriptName
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-ResultLimit

Sonuç sınırı, sınır olmadan '-1'.

Type:Int32
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-SqlDatabaseName

SQL betiğinin hangi veritabanını kullanacağını.

Type:String
Position:Named
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-SqlPoolName

SQL betiğinin bağlandığı sql havuzu.

Type:String
Position:Named
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-WhatIf

Cmdlet çalıştırılıyorsa ne olacağını gösterir. Cmdlet çalıştırılmaz.

Type:SwitchParameter
Aliases:wi
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-WorkspaceName

Synapse çalışma alanının adı.

Type:String
Position:Named
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-WorkspaceObject

çalışma alanı giriş nesnesi, genellikle işlem hattından geçirilir.

Type:PSSynapseWorkspace
Position:Named
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

Girişler

PSSynapseWorkspace

Çıkışlar

PSSqlScriptResource